CHAPTER 1 - MARKET SUMMARY

Market Overview

The Global Smart Medical Devices Market operates through recurring sensor consumables, connected therapeutic hardware, monitoring equipment and software-enabled device ecosystems. Diabetes technology remains a central demand engine: approximately 589 million adults were living with diabetes globally in 2024, while the underlying market model identifies CGM and automated insulin delivery as more than 30% of connected-device value.

Revenue remains concentrated in developed healthcare systems where reimbursement, clinical infrastructure and digital connectivity support premium devices. North America represented approximately 35.9% of broad smart-medical-device revenue in 2024, while Asia Pacific accounted for about 20.4%. This concentration favors manufacturers with integrated payer access, clinical evidence, distribution scale and interoperable device platforms.

Future Outlook

The Global Smart Medical Devices Market is forecast to progress from approximately USD 60 billion in 2025 toward USD 140 billion by 2032, representing an underlying model CAGR of 13.0%. This follows an estimated historical CAGR of approximately 12.0% during 2020-2025. Growth is expected to remain structurally stronger than the overall medical-device industry because smart-device revenues benefit from recurring sensors, software, connected consumables and remote monitoring workflows. CGM penetration, automated insulin delivery, connected respiratory therapy and hospital-to-home monitoring are expected to remain the largest recurring revenue pools, while clinically authorized consumer-device capabilities expand addressable demand.

Value expansion should outpace physical-unit growth as connected products capture more software, analytics and clinical-workflow value per deployed device. The pre-validated operating model indicates approximately 10% unit growth against approximately 13% value growth, implying continued favorable mix despite component cost deflation. FDA authorization of OTC glucose sensing and sensor-driven sleep-apnea functions demonstrates how formerly specialist monitoring capabilities can migrate toward broader populations. The key investment question therefore shifts from device shipment growth alone toward installed users, recurring sensor consumption, reimbursement coverage, interoperable data platforms and regulated AI functionality that increases lifetime revenue per connected patient.

Historical Market Performance (2020-2025)

Historical expansion accelerated toward the end of the period as diabetes technology, home monitoring and recurring connected-device consumables increased their contribution to industry revenue. The operating model indicates physical device-equivalent volume moving from approximately 93 million units in 2020 to 152 million units in 2025. Value growth exceeded unit growth in four of the five annual intervals shown, indicating that software content, recurring consumables and premium clinical functionality increasingly supported realized revenue per device-equivalent.

Forecast Market Outlook (2025-2032)

The forecast assumes continued separation between approximately 10% unit growth and 13.0% underlying value CAGR. Device-equivalent volume is projected to approach 295 million units by 2032, while the modeled value-volume growth spread remains generally between two and four percentage points. Revenue expansion is concentrated in automated diabetes management, sensor-based home monitoring, connected respiratory therapy and regulated wearable functionality, with AI-enabled interpretation increasing the economic value of data generated by each deployed sensor or device.

Active CGM Users

12.5 million modeled users, 2025, global. The addressable pool remains substantially larger: IDF estimates 589 million adults were living with diabetes in 2024, supporting long-duration sensor penetration and recurring consumable revenue.

Connected Sleep Therapy Users

19.8 million modeled users, 2025, global. Sleep monitoring is broadening beyond dedicated therapy hardware after FDA clearance of Apple’s Sleep Apnea Notification Feature in September 2024, expanding the consumer-to-clinical identification funnel.

Clinically Enabled Wearable Users

145 million modeled users, 2025, global. FDA’s sensor-based digital-health-device framework explicitly includes smartwatches, rings, patches and bands, strengthening the regulatory pathway for clinically relevant wearable sensing beyond traditional medical-device form factors.

CHAPTER 7 - Regional Analysis

Regional Analysis

The global market remains led by North America, while Europe provides a second large reimbursement-supported pool and Asia Pacific represents the strongest structural expansion opportunity. Regional differences primarily reflect reimbursement maturity, regulatory pathways, chronic-disease burden, clinical infrastructure and affordability of recurring sensors.

Growth Drivers, Challenges & Opportunities

Comprehensive analysis of key factors shaping the Global Smart Medical Devices Market, including growth catalysts, operational challenges, and emerging opportunities across production, distribution, and consumer segments.

Growth Drivers

Expanding Chronic Disease Monitoring Base

  • Diabetes prevalence is projected to reach 853 million adults (2050, global), extending the addressable patient pool for CGM, automated insulin delivery and connected metabolic monitoring.
  • Cardiovascular diseases caused approximately 19.8 million deaths (2022, global), supporting investment in rhythm detection, cardiac monitoring and post-discharge connected care.
  • More than 80% of premature NCD deaths (WHO, global) are associated with cardiovascular disease, cancers, chronic respiratory disease and diabetes, strengthening the strategic case for longitudinal monitoring.

Reimbursement and Hospital-to-Home Care

  • Medicare broadly covers RPM for acute and chronic conditions (2026, United States), supporting device deployment outside hospitals and recurring monitoring workflows.
  • CMS previously finalized payment for seven RPM codes (2021 policy framework, United States), creating a durable reimbursement architecture for connected physiologic monitoring.
  • Philips announced a hospital-at-home program designed to support up to 15,000 patients annually (2026, Stockholm region), illustrating institutional scaling of remote monitoring beyond pilot deployments.

Regulatory Expansion of Sensor-Based Digital Health

  • Dexcom Stelo became the first OTC CGM for adults (2024, United States), opening glucose biosensing to populations not using insulin.
  • The FDA cleared Apple’s Sleep Apnea Notification Feature on September 13, 2024 (United States), validating consumer wearables as regulated screening interfaces.
  • The FDA’s sensor-based digital-health-device framework explicitly covers four common wearable formats (2026, United States): smartwatches, rings, patches and bands.

Market Challenges

Cybersecurity and Lifecycle Compliance Costs

  • Cyber-device submissions must demonstrate compliance with Section 524B cybersecurity requirements (FDA, United States), making secure architecture part of premarket readiness rather than a post-launch IT function.
  • The FDA issued updated final cybersecurity guidance in 2026 (United States), increasing the need for continuous regulatory monitoring, vulnerability management and controlled software updates.
  • Connected medical-device developers must fund security throughout the product lifecycle, creating additional cost exposure across products with multi-year installed lives (global smart-device model).

Regulatory Fragmentation Across Major Markets

  • Higher-risk legacy devices can face transition requirements extending to December 31, 2027 (European Union), requiring manufacturers to coordinate clinical evidence and quality systems well ahead of commercial deadlines.
  • Applicable lower-risk categories can transition through December 31, 2028 (European Union), creating parallel compliance pathways across legacy and MDR-certified portfolios.
  • Global manufacturers must simultaneously address FDA, EU MDR and country-specific approvals across a market with approximately 4,885 modeled manufacturers (global), favoring scaled regulatory organizations over small undifferentiated hardware vendors.

Revenue Attribution and Hardware Price Compression

  • Consumer-electronics manufacturers do not separately disclose clinical-feature revenue, leaving approximately USD 4.2 billion of modeled 2024 value dependent on feature-attribution assumptions.
  • Dexcom reported approximately 61% non-GAAP gross-margin guidance for 2025, demonstrating that sensor economics remain attractive but sensitive to manufacturing efficiency and commercial mix.
  • ResMed reported a 59.4% gross margin in FY2025, highlighting the value of scale and recurring masks, accessories and connected therapy despite ongoing hardware cost competition.

Market Opportunities

OTC Biosensing and Broader Metabolic Monitoring

  • Recurring sensor replacement revenue (2025-2032, global) offers a monetizable model combining hardware, consumables, analytics and optional subscriptions rather than relying only on one-time device sales.
  • CGM developers, pharmacies, digital-health platforms and payers benefit as the potential audience extends beyond approximately 11 million modeled active CGM users in 2024.
  • Commercial scale requires lower sensor cost, clearer non-diabetes clinical use cases and broader coverage, with 589 million adults with diabetes in 2024 remaining the core evidence-backed demand pool.

Consumer Wearables as Clinical Screening Gateways

  • Device manufacturers can monetize continuous sensor engagement across multi-year ownership cycles through clinical features, interpretation services and referral workflows rather than relying solely on replacement hardware.
  • Hospitals, sleep clinics, cardiologists and wearable manufacturers benefit as approximately 130 million health-feature-engaged wearable devices in the 2024 model create a large screening interface.
  • Value capture depends on clinically validated algorithms and interoperable referral pathways, with FDA clearance providing a regulated authorization route in the United States for sensor-derived health functions.

Emerging-Market Connected Care

  • Lower-cost sensors and modular RPM platforms provide a monetizable pathway into regions where Asia Pacific benchmarks approximately 13.3% CAGR through 2030.
  • Manufacturers, local distributors, health systems and digital-health platforms can target the 322 million adults with diabetes across Western Pacific and South-East Asia IDF regions in 2024.
  • Realization requires reimbursement localization, lower recurring consumable costs and scalable digital infrastructure because four in five adults with diabetes live in lower-income markets.

Competitive Landscape Overview

The market combines meaningful category concentration with a fragmented long tail. The pre-validated model places CR5 at approximately 34.9% and CR10 at 53.1%, with diabetes technology forming the most concentrated major revenue pool.
